The Securitization practice group has focused on representing issuers, borrowers and trustees, but has also represented underwriters, purchasers and warehouse lenders. We have handled a number of "first of its kind" securitizations, including the first net interest margin securitization, the first section 150(d)(3) conversion of a student loan program, the first securitization of agricultural commodities and the first securitization of destroyed notes.
Dorsey’s Securitization practice group attorneys have extensive experience in the securitization of a wide variety of assets, including:
- Student loans
- Manufactured housing loans
- Automobile loans
- Home improvement and home equity loans
- Credit card receivables
- Trade receivables
- Equipment leases
- Agricultural commodities
- Residential mortgage loans
- Commercial real estate
- Life settlements
